Lynxpaw's eyes cracked open, and he let out a yawn. Moss clung to his brown grey coat, and it shook it free with a groan. Blinking against the sunlight, he stretched his forepaws, claws extended, then dragged himself outside. Instantly sunlight beamed down on him, and he purred in its warmth. Licking his lips, he made his way over to the fresh kill pile, only to remember that he couldn't eat until he'd hunted for the Clan. His eyes scanned the clearing for his mentor, but he guessed that Sparknose was out on patrol, because he was nowhere to be seen. Whiskers twitching in annoyance, Lynxpaw made a mental note to get up earlier. He padded into the apprentices den and saw his sister, Squirrelpaw, still snoring in her nest. He prodded her with his forepaw. "Wake up, Squirrelpaw." he breathed in her ear.

Squirrelpaw's eyes snapped open and she glanced around the den in alarm, wondering who'd woken her from her dream, but calmed when she realized it had been Lynxpaw. "You furball," she growled, leaping out of her den and tackling the tom cat. Lynxpaw let out a yelp in surprise, and he cuffed her ear gently. They tumbled over some nests, wrestling each other, until finally Lynxpaw had her pinned. He grinned. "Gotcha again!" he mewed in triumph, but Squirrelpaw didn't give up. She kicked her brother with her hind paws, sending him sprawling out the entrance. She sprung up like a rabbit, extending her forepaws in front of her, and landed squarely on top of him. Lynxpaw let out a whoosh of air, and he laughed. "Alright, you got me."
